What is the Spot Trading Binance Fee?
The spot trading Binance fee refers to the commission charged by Binance for executing trades on its platform. This fee is a percentage of the total transaction value and varies depending on the trading volume and the user's trading tier. Binance has a tiered fee structure that rewards users for higher trading volumes, offering lower fees for more active traders.

Factors Influencing the Spot Trading Binance Fee
1. Trading Volume: As mentioned earlier, Binance has a tiered fee structure that rewards users for higher trading volumes. The more a user trades, the lower their fee rate becomes. This encourages active trading and rewards loyalty.
2. Trading Tier: Binance divides its users into different trading tiers based on their trading volume over the past 30 days. Each tier has a corresponding fee rate. The higher the tier, the lower the fee rate.
3. Market: The fee rate can vary depending on the market in which the trade is executed. Some markets may have higher fee rates than others.
4. Trading Pair: The fee rate can also differ based on the trading pair. For example, trading pairs with higher liquidity may have lower fee rates compared to less liquid pairs.
Strategies for Minimizing Spot Trading Binance Fees
1. Increase Trading Volume: One of the most effective ways to reduce spot trading Binance fees is to increase your trading volume. By doing so, you can move up to higher trading tiers, which offer lower fee rates.
2. Choose Low-Fee Trading Pairs: Opt for trading pairs with lower fee rates. While this may not always be possible, it can help in reducing your overall trading costs.
3. Utilize Binance Referral Program: Binance offers a referral program that allows users to earn a portion of their referral's trading fees. By referring new users to the platform, you can potentially offset some of your own fees.
4. Optimize Trading Strategy: Implement a trading strategy that maximizes your profits while minimizing the number of trades. This can help in reducing the overall transaction value and, consequently, the fees.
5. Stay Informed: Keep track of the latest fee changes and market trends. This will help you make informed decisions and adjust your trading strategy accordingly.
